May 26, 2026Inspection Completed - No Further ActionRoutine Inspection

Met inspection standards. 9 violations recorded, none serious enough to require a return visit.

2 High priority3 Intermediate4 Basic
What the inspector wrote — 9 findings
Employee began working with food, handling clean equipment or utensils, or touching unwrapped single-service items without first washing hands. Observed employee changing task and no washing hands.
High priority/12A-16-4
Time/temperature control for safety food identified in the written procedure as a food held using time as a public health control has no time marking and the time removed from temperature control cannot be determined. Observed boiled eggs, honey dew melons and cantaloupe, yogurt parfait at the buffet area. Operator maintains by time. No labels observed. Operator add the time at time of inspection. All items were in the line for less than 4 hours.
High priority/03F-02-5/Corrected On-Site
Handwash sink used for purposes other than handwashing. Observed handwashing sink with items stored inside. Operator removed items.
Intermediate/31A-11-4/Corrected On-Site
No measuring device available for measuring utensil surface temperature when using hot water as sanitizer in a dishmachine.
Intermediate/16-62-1

Dec 14, 2023Inspection Completed - No Further ActionRoutine Inspection

Met inspection standards. 8 violations recorded, none serious enough to require a return visit.

2 High priority6 Intermediate0 Basic
Show 8 findings ▾
Single-use gloves not changed as needed after changing tasks or when damaged or soiled. Employee moved garbage can and proceeded to make waffles without changing gloves and washing hands. Manager had employee wash hands and change gloves.
High priority/12A-09-4/Corrective Action Taken
Time/temperature control for safety food identified in the written procedure as a food held using time as a public health control has no time marking. Cut melons, boiled eggs and butter on buffet not time marked. Manager stated items placed on buffet at 8 am, employee placed proper time mark on item. Manager stated going forward the paperwork would state items would be held from 8 am to 10 am.
High priority/03F-02-5
Establishment has no written procedures for employees to follow in response to a vomiting or diarrheal event where the vomit or diarrhea is discharged onto surfaces in the establishment. No written procedure available. Inspector provided operator with written procedure.
Intermediate/11-27-4/Corrective Action Taken/Repeat Violation
Food-contact surface soiled with food debris, mold-like substance or slime. Hot water nozzle on guest water machine.
Intermediate/22-02-4
Handwash sink used for purposes other than handwashing. Cloths stored in kitchen hand washing sink. Employee moved cloths from sink.
Intermediate/31A-11-4/Repeat Violation
No chemical test kit provided when using sanitizer at three-compartment sink/warewashing machine or wiping cloths. No chlorine test kit available.
Intermediate/16-37-1
No paper towels or mechanical hand drying device provided at handwash sink. No hand towels at kitchen hand washing sink. Manager provided hand towels to sink.
Intermediate/31B-02-4/Corrected On-Site
Wash solution in spray-type chemical warewasher less than 120 degrees Fahrenheit. Kitchen dish machine, 115F.
Intermediate/16-53-4
